detumescence

Syllabification: (de·tu·mes·cence)
Definition of detumescence

noun

  • the process of subsiding from a state of tension, swelling, or (especially) sexual arousal.

Derivatives

detumesce

Pronunciation: /-ˈmes/
verb

detumescent

adjective

Origin:

late 17th century: from Latin detumescere, from de- 'down, away'+ tumescere 'to swell'
